Bill 384: REZONING REQUEST - KAHAKAI ASSOCIATES (C-2219) PUAPUAA 2ND, NORTH KONA TAX MAP KEY 7-5-20:1 - 108.3 ACRES Amends Section 25-87 (North Kona Zone Map), Article 3, Chapter 25 (Zoning Code) of the Hawaii County Code, by changing the district classification from Unplanned (U) to Single Family Residential (RS-7.5) at Puapuaa 1st and 2nd, North Kona. Intr. by: Mr. Domingo 1st Reading: February 6, 1991 PC-49 Page 3 February 27, 1991 Comm. 2267: From Gary Okamoto, Project Manager, Wilson Okamoto and Associates, dated January 28, 1991, submitting for information, in response to Councilwoman Merle Lai's request at the PC meeting on January 23, 1991, 1) the Traffic Assessment for the Kahakai Residential Project dated March 5, 1990, and 2) the Supplemental Analysis, Traffic Assessment for Kahakai Residential Project dated March 9, 1990. Intr, by: Mr. Domingo 1st Reading: February 20, 1991 UNFINISHED BUSINESS Comm. 2098: KEAHOLE TO KAILUA DEVELOPMENT PLAN (Bill 363) From Planning Commission Chairman Fred Fujimoto and Planning Director Duane Kanuha, dated October 22, 1990, informing after duly held public hearings, the Planning Commission voted to recommend approval of the Keahole to Kailua Development Plan with the revisions dated May 22, 1990. Transmits for the Council's consideration a bill adopting the plan and requesting consideration be given to: 1) Water availability for the planned development; 2) The location of the University campus; 3) Private sector willingness to participate in infrastructure financing; and 4) Potential traffic problems at the Palani Road-Kuakini Highway intersection. Further, informs the Commission requests that a night hearing be held in Kona for the purpose of securing additional public input.
